Overview

Glorit is a small rural community located in the Rodney District of New Zealand's North Island. The settlement is situated on the eastern side of the Kaipara Harbour, providing stunning views of the water and surrounding countryside. With a population of just over 500 people, it is a tight-knit community that takes pride in its natural environment and rural lifestyle. Visitors are drawn to Glorit for its peaceful atmosphere and opportunities for outdoor recreation.

History

Glorit was originally settled by Maori tribes, who were attracted to the area for its rich natural resources and fertile land. European settlers arrived in the mid-19th century and the settlement grew into a thriving farming community. Today, Glorit is known for its rural charm and stunning landscapes, which provide a glimpse into the area's rich history and cultural heritage.

Geography

Glorit is located on the eastern side of the Kaipara Harbour, providing stunning views of the water and surrounding countryside. The settlement is situated near several rivers and streams, including the Waiwhiu Stream, which flows through the center of town. The area is known for its natural beauty and is a popular destination for out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ing and camping. The settlement is also located near several beaches and coastal areas, making it an ideal base for exploring the region.

Demographics

Glorit has a population of just over 500 people. The settlement is predominantly European, with a small Maori population. The area is known for its friendly and welcoming community and visitors are always made to feel at home. The settlement is home to a mix of farmers, tradespeople and other professionals who have chosen to make Glorit their home.

Climate

Glorit has a temperate climate with mild, wet winters and warm, dry summers. The area receives a moderate amount of rainfall throughout the year, which helps to keep the surrounding farmland and forests green and lush. The settlement is located near the coast, which can make it prone to strong winds and storms during the cooler months.

Economy

Glorit's economy is based primarily on agriculture and tourism. The settlement is surrounded by farmland and many residents work in the agricultural industry. Tourism is a growing industry in the area, with visitors coming to the region to enjoy the natural scenery and outdoor activities. The settlement has several cafes, restaurants and shops that cater to visitors.
